The localization process of the original Dōbutsu no Mori was particularly challenging due to its heavy reliance on Japanese cultural references that posed difficulties even for Japanese players.
In 2001, few could have predicted the soaring success of Animal Crossing, which evolved from a Japan-only Nintendo 64 game into one of the biggest franchises in gaming.
Animal Crossing's success illustrates the significant impact of cultural adaptation, showing how traditionally localized games can resonate universally with global audiences.
Boss Fight Books' 2024 release on Animal Crossing sheds light on the extensive efforts required to make the series appealing to Western players.
